NEWS RELEASE - Town of Devon implements Temporary Mandatory Face Covering Bylaw As of Nov. 24, 2020, face coverings are mandatory in all indoor publicly accessible spaces within the Town of Devon, following a motion made by Devon Council to pass third reading of a Temporary Mandatory Face Covering Bylaw at their Nov. 23, 2020 Council Meeting. Enactment of this Bylaw means that face coverings are now required to be worn inside all public spaces within the Town of Devon includi...ng buildings and ride-for-hire services with some exceptions. This follows the approach of municipalities throughout the Edmonton Region who have engaged medical experts to help manage rising COVID-19 cases as the majority of these communities, including Devon, are now under an enhanced watch with increased restrictions provided by the provincial government. Municipalities are put under a watch if they have 50 active COVID-19 cases per 100,000 population with a minimum of 10 active cases. As of Nov. 23, 2020, the Leduc County Region, which Devon is a part of, is sitting at 305 active cases per 100,000 and 73 active cases. This is not a decision we took lightly as we have had numerous deliberations over the past months on our role when it comes to public health as a Municipal Council, said Ray Ralph, Mayor for the Town of Devon. Our approach to mandatory face coverings will be cooperative rather than punitive, and as this is now the norm throughout the Edmonton Region, we are trusting our residents to do the right thing and routinely wear a face covering when out in public to do their part to prevent the spread of COVID-19. Bylaw Exceptions There are some key exceptions to the Bylaw including: Persons under the age of 10 Persons unable to place, use, or remove a face covering without assistance Persons unable to wear a face covering due to a mental or physical concern or limitation The Temporary Mandatory Face Covering Bylaw will remain in effect until Devon is taken off of a watch for 30 consecutive days.
